I did a valve adjustment a few months ago and had a pronounced clicking on the right side. I figured I did a boo-boo but wasn't too concerned. I took it apart Saturday and found that I probably applied the exhaust specs to the #4 intake and had a .265 shim installed when I should have had a .275. Got the right one in and it now has just the right amount of noise. The last time I did the valves, I had the cams out, so I didn't need to use the shim tool. It has been a few years since I had used the tool and forgot that the valve needs to be depressed by the cam beforeinstalling the tool. I sat there for 30 minutes trying to figure out what I was doing wrong before breaking down and looking in my manual.

Oil Leak with Easy Fix
In the mid-summer, I developed an oil leak at the bottom of the stator cover on my SF. If I rode for a half-hour, 2-3 drops would accumulate at the bottom of the cover.
We know the possible causes are:
(a) galley plug o-ring
(b) crank seal.
I bought both parts and procrastinated....until now.
Last night I pulled the cover, and I could see it was the galley plug leaking.
This fix took 15 minutes because I was careful to wipe everything super clean.
Moral: Don't be afraid of this fix, it's super easy.Leave a comment:

Here you go. I marked the pilot tower fuel levels and the pilot jet location at the bottom of its screwdriver slot on the jet inlet face.
The carburetor body 'lip' used to check the fuel levels externally with the clear hose goes away at the carburetor inlet. I had to measure the float bowl gasket surface offset to 'zero' the float gauge so I could square the gauge, then measure and mark the pilot tower fuel levels at 2mm, 3mm, and 4mm.
The internal fuel levels are 4.5mm, 5.5mm, and 6.6mm from the float bowl gasket surface that's used to set the float height.
XJ1100 float bowl gasket surface offset 2.5mm

XJ1100 pilot tower fuel levels marked 2m to 4mm with jet height

Levels
I always use the lowest part of the carb body where you had your caliper in the top photo, and have never had them leak with mikuni seats and metal on metal needles. I did a running test at various rpms with my LH and marked the levels from idle to 5.5 k. Of course the bike was on the center stand so it wasn't under load but it confirmed with the assistance of TC's cutaway that, plus or minus 2mm from the lowest edge of the carb body ensures that the pilot jet is always feed. I believe that there was 4mm to spare. My thoughts were that once your into the mains over 5.5 k there is lots of fuel, and the bowls recover amazingly fast so when you chop the throttle back, the pilot cct has plenty to provide the smooth transition when the butterflies start to close. A Tale Of Two Millimeters
That was interesting, there is as tab/flange on all XS1100 and XJ1100 carburetor bodies as shown in the illustration, it's a step up in the carburetor body on the inlet side and, fortunately, you can't really get a measurement from that point so there's no way to flub the measurement.
I set a float gauge to 4mm and took some pictures.
The written 3mm spec is closer to the actual 4mm fuel levels measured from the carburetor body when the float height is set to 23mm.
The illustrated 3mm spec is closer to the illustration when it's measured from the float bowl casting step.
Based on the fuel levels I measured with the floats set to 23mm, I'll take a wild guess that 3mm is measured from the carburetor body, not the float bowl casting step, but it seems to me that it would be a little high if it went all the way up to the 2mm upper limit.
I'll reset the float heights to get a 2mm fuel level and see if it runs or dumps fuel out the air box.
